The first known live performance of Twin and one of only two known performances of the song today. Though likely performed in the early days before the band were signed to a record label, this is likely the debut of the song on the Showbiz tour. Dom threw his drumsticks as well as a cymbal into the audience at the end of Showbiz.[3]
